Convert miles per hour to meters per second. Round the answer to the nearest whole number. (1 mile = 1,609 meters, 1 hour = 3,600 seconds)

65 miles per hour = ???? meters per second.

Convert 65 miles per hour to meters per second. Round the answer to the nearest whole number. (1 mile = 1,609 meters, 1 hour = 3,600 seconds)

To convert, we will follow the steps below;

First lets change 65 miles to meters.

To do that, we will simply use proportion;

Let x represent 65 miles in meters

1 mile = 1609 meters

65 miles= x

cross-multiply

x = 65 × 1609

x = 104585 meters

65 miles = 104585 meters

when we see 'per hour' it shows we are dividing by 1 hour

1 hour = 3600 seconds, this implies we will divide 104585 by 3600

65 miles per hour =
(104585)/(3600) = 29.05 ≈ 29 meters per second to the nearest whole number

You want to convert 65 mph to the nearest whole number of meters per second.

Conversion

Units conversion is accomplished by multiplying by a fraction that cancels the units you have and replaces them with the units you want. The numerator and denominator of the fraction are made equal.


65\frac{\text{ mi}}{\text{ h}}=65\frac{\text{ mi}}{\text{ h}}\cdot\frac{1609\text{ m}}{1\text{ mi}}\cdot\frac{1\text{ h}}{3600\text{ s}}=(65\cdot 1609)/(3600)\cdot\frac{\text{mi\,h\,m}}{\text{mi\,h\,s}}\approx \boxed{29\text{ m/s}}
